Anyway, that assumes Mao dying alone would cause Kuomintang victory. Maybe early on it would, but after the Long March I don't think so. Mao was a good commander but Communists didn't win the Civil War because of one man, they won because they could credibly promise the peasants land reform and the Kuomintang couldn't and because of help from the Soviets.
